In this week’s episode of Africa and the Global Illicit Economy, we take a look at current trends in organised crime in East and Southern Africa --- From the  illicit smuggling of arms and ammunition from Yemen to Somalia;  the worrying rise of high-profile kidnappings in Mozambique; and the possible emergence of an organised illicit trade in donkey skins from Kenya. 

Presenter: Lindy Mtongana

Speakers

Estacio Valoi - Investigative journalist based in Mozambique.

Samantha Opere - Samantha Opere is a Veterinary Surgeon and Project Manager at  Kenya Network for Dissemination of Agricultural Technologies. 

Jay Bahadur - author of The Pirates of Somalia and guest editor of the Global Initiative's East and Southern Africa Risk Bulletin.
